Moving forward, we delve into the Breakout Trading Strategy, which is designed to take advantage of significant price movements that surpass defined support or resistance thresholds. This strategy typically serves as a precursor for notable shifts in price and increases in volatility, offering opportunities for considerable gains. Traders use an array of instruments including On-Balance-Volume, Bollinger Bands, and Donchian Channels to pinpoint possible breakout scenarios. The Simple Moving Average (SMA) is one of the most commonly used indicators in trend trading. It is calculated by averaging a set number of past prices over a specified period. The SMA helps to smooth out price data and makes it easier to identify the overall direction of the market. Fundamental analysis in forex trading delves into the economic elements that influence the Forex market, unlike technical analysis which examines price patterns and trends. This type of strategy utilizes a thorough assessment of central bank policies, interest rates, and other economic data to make educated forex trades.

Technical analysis professionals use chart patterns to interpret market behavior, predicting future price movements using shapes like head and shoulders, double tops, and triangles. If one pair becomes very unstable, the effects on the whole portfolio are less severe. A common way to manage risk is by risking only a small percentage of the account per trade. For example, some traders choose to risk just 1% or 2% of their total trading balance on each signal.
